Full job description
Sign-On Bonus!
The responsibilities of this job include, but are not limited to, the following:
Supervising the medical care of all patients from registration to departure;
Supervising clinical personnel on their patient contact, care, and performance;
Scheduling Staff Nurses and Medical Assistants;
Reviewing and supervising the inventory of medicines, prescriptions, and supplies;
Acting as Patient First representative for the Director of Medical Support and the Medical Director in his or her absence to ensure smooth operation of the center;
Functioning as an administrator and working as a Staff Nurse as needed;
Reviewing all checklists of Staff Nurses and Medical Assistants;
Preparing written and verbal evaluations for Staff Nurses and Medical Assistants at appropriate scheduled time, or when necessary;
Providing positive, warm and friendly customer service in all interactions;
Fostering teamwork and a positive, professional atmosphere;
Completing other duties as directed.
Minimum education and professional requirements include, but are not limited to, the following:
Employee must be at least 18 years of age;
High school graduate or equivalent;
Keyboarding experience required;
Excellent verbal and written communication skills;
One year of clerical experience preferred;
One year of clinical experience with administration of medications preferred;
One year of supervisory experience preferred;
Licensed to practice as a Nurse by the state of Pennsylvania.

Founded by a physician in 1981, Patient First provides non-appointment urgent care for routine injuries and illnesses as well as primary care for patients who do not have a regular physician. All Patient First medical centers are open every day of the year from 8 am to 8 pm, including all holidays, and are located throughout the Mid-Atlantic region.
